资料验证的asp.net程序
生活随笔
收集整理的這篇文章主要介紹了
资料验证的asp.net程序
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
<!-------資料驗(yàn)證:天樂(lè)comezxn@sina.com------------>
<!-------比較簡(jiǎn)單,以前寫的,若有紕漏,請(qǐng)跟我聯(lián)系---------->
<Html>
<Body?bgcolor="White">
<H3>Validator(資料驗(yàn)證)控制元件<Hr></H3>
<Form?runat="server">
<Blockquote>
Email:<asp:TextBox?id="Email"?runat="server"/>
<asp:RegularExpressionValidator?id="Valid1"?runat="server"
ControlToValidate="Email"
ValidationExpression=".{1,}@.{3,}"?>
(Email?應(yīng)含有@號(hào))
</asp:RegularExpressionValidator><p>
您的電話:<asp:TextBox?id="Tel"?runat="server"/>
<asp:RegularExpressionValidator?id="Valid2"?runat="server"
ControlToValidate="Tel"
ValidationExpression="/([0-9]{2,3}/)[0-9]{2,4}-[0-9]{4}"?>
(區(qū)號(hào))您的電話
</asp:RegularExpressionValidator><p>
您的地址:<asp:TextBox?Size=60?id="Addr"?runat="server"/>
<!--------仿照了王國(guó)榮的《asp.net領(lǐng)先研究》的程序------------>
<asp:RegularExpressionValidator?id="Valid3"?runat="server"
ControlToValidate="Addr"
ValidationExpression="(.{1,}(市|鎮(zhèn)|鄉(xiāng)).{1,}(路|街|道).{1,}號(hào).{0,})|(.{1,}郵政.{1,}信箱)"?>
(必須含有?'市鎮(zhèn)鄉(xiāng)'、'路街道'、'號(hào)'?或?'郵政'、信箱')
</asp:RegularExpressionValidator><p>
<asp:Button?id="Button1"?Text="?輸入?"?runat="server"
OnClick="Button1_Click"?/>
<asp:Label?id="Label1"?runat="server"/>
</Blockquote></form>
<Hr></body>
</html>
<script?Language="c#"?runat="server">
public?void?Button1_Click?(object?sender,?System.EventArgs?e)?
{
If(Page.IsValid)?{
Label1.Text?=?"<p><Font?Color=Red>資料驗(yàn)證?OK!</Font>"
Button1.Visible?=?False
}
}?
</script>
<!-------比較簡(jiǎn)單,以前寫的,若有紕漏,請(qǐng)跟我聯(lián)系---------->
<Html>
<Body?bgcolor="White">
<H3>Validator(資料驗(yàn)證)控制元件<Hr></H3>
<Form?runat="server">
<Blockquote>
Email:<asp:TextBox?id="Email"?runat="server"/>
<asp:RegularExpressionValidator?id="Valid1"?runat="server"
ControlToValidate="Email"
ValidationExpression=".{1,}@.{3,}"?>
(Email?應(yīng)含有@號(hào))
</asp:RegularExpressionValidator><p>
您的電話:<asp:TextBox?id="Tel"?runat="server"/>
<asp:RegularExpressionValidator?id="Valid2"?runat="server"
ControlToValidate="Tel"
ValidationExpression="/([0-9]{2,3}/)[0-9]{2,4}-[0-9]{4}"?>
(區(qū)號(hào))您的電話
</asp:RegularExpressionValidator><p>
您的地址:<asp:TextBox?Size=60?id="Addr"?runat="server"/>
<!--------仿照了王國(guó)榮的《asp.net領(lǐng)先研究》的程序------------>
<asp:RegularExpressionValidator?id="Valid3"?runat="server"
ControlToValidate="Addr"
ValidationExpression="(.{1,}(市|鎮(zhèn)|鄉(xiāng)).{1,}(路|街|道).{1,}號(hào).{0,})|(.{1,}郵政.{1,}信箱)"?>
(必須含有?'市鎮(zhèn)鄉(xiāng)'、'路街道'、'號(hào)'?或?'郵政'、信箱')
</asp:RegularExpressionValidator><p>
<asp:Button?id="Button1"?Text="?輸入?"?runat="server"
OnClick="Button1_Click"?/>
<asp:Label?id="Label1"?runat="server"/>
</Blockquote></form>
<Hr></body>
</html>
<script?Language="c#"?runat="server">
public?void?Button1_Click?(object?sender,?System.EventArgs?e)?
{
If(Page.IsValid)?{
Label1.Text?=?"<p><Font?Color=Red>資料驗(yàn)證?OK!</Font>"
Button1.Visible?=?False
}
}?
</script>
總結(jié)
以上是生活随笔為你收集整理的资料验证的asp.net程序的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: ASP.NET的WebFrom组件Lin
- 下一篇: PEAR, PECL和Perl的区别